为什么我的Azure辅助角色重新启动?

时间:2018-01-11 15:34:57

标签: c# multithreading azure azure-worker-roles azure-cloud-services

我觉得我在云服务或异步(或两者)上缺少一些基本的理解,所以如果这是基本的,我会道歉。然而,尽管在过去几个月里花了几个小时进行研究,我还没有找到一篇文章或其他资源给我一个" Aha!"时刻。

我有一个运行单个辅助角色的Azure Classic Cloud Service。作为启动任务,它会检查目录中的Chrome并在其丢失时进行安装。在我的开发机器上,我没有在该位置使用Chrome,因此每次调试会话我都会获得安装Chrome的权限#34;对话,正如所料。

我发现,在本地调试时,如果我在一个断点(或踩踏)停留超过90秒,我将再次获得"安装Chrome"对话和VS会提醒我,我只调试多个线程中的一个。

如果我需要发布任何代码来阐明这一点,我会很高兴(但我无法确定可能相关的内容)。到底发生了什么,我是否可以控制何时重启"或者"新线程触发器"会发生什么?

0 个答案:

没有答案